software suite Options
This expanding desire means there’s never ever been an even better time and energy to enter the sphere. In case you’re thinking about Understanding how to become a software engineer and future-proof your job, Please read on.Build Python modules, operate device checks, and offer purposes when making certain the PEP8 coding very best practices
You must find out how to write excellent clean up code that is a snap to grasp and keep. So as to try this, You will need to examine a whole lot and find out numerous examples of fine code.
Led by professional Agile trainers, this schooling offers teams having a deep knowledge of Scrum framework essentials, roles, ceremonies, and functional tools and techniques to navigate Agile projects with self-assurance and proficiency.
Demonstrate how to prepare for the career look for, which include investigating businesses, figuring out acceptable roles, and producing crucial
Within a letter to IEEE Personal computer, Steven Rakitin expressed cynicism about agile software development, contacting it "One more try and undermine the self-control of software engineering" and translating "Functioning software above comprehensive documentation" as "we want to expend all our time coding. Bear in mind, true programmers Will not publish documentation."[forty seven]
CareerOneStop features a huge selection of occupational profiles with info accessible by state and metro place. You'll find inbound links while in the still left-hand side menu to check occupational work by condition and occupational wages by regional space or metro area. There may be also a salary facts Resource to look for wages by zip more info code.
When agile software development is used inside of a dispersed location (with teams dispersed across several business areas), it is usually often called dispersed agile software development. The aim would be to leverage the exclusive benefits offered by Every method. Dispersed development will allow corporations to construct software by strategically creating groups in various areas of the globe, practically making software round-the-clock (much more generally called stick to-the-Sunshine design).
Should have 5 or maybe more several years of expertise in software development, screening, business enterprise Evaluation, and products or job management
The solution operator is to blame for symbolizing the business enterprise within the development exercise and is usually probably the most demanding role.[108]
In May possibly 2024, the median yearly wages for software developers in the top industries by which they labored were as follows:
¹Productive application and enrollment are demanded. Eligibility requirements implement. Each individual establishment establishes the number of credits recognized by completing this content that will count towards degree prerequisites, taking into consideration any existing credits maybe you have. Click a certain course for more information.
Software builders create the computer applications that permit consumers to accomplish certain jobs along with the fundamental techniques that operate the equipment or Regulate networks. Software high quality assurance analysts and testers style and design and execute software checks to identify challenges and learn the way the software is effective.
Crystal considers development a series of co-operative online games, and intends which the documentation is enough to assistance the subsequent get at another activity. The perform products and solutions for Crystal incorporate use cases, chance listing, iteration plan, core domain models, and design notes to inform on choices.